Forest Service to Ignite Prescribed Burn near Shaver Lake
Contact: Sue Exline (559) 297-0706 ext 4804

For immediate release.

Clovis, CA (June 6, 2010)...Beginning Tuesday, June 8th, the Sierra National Forest will ignite a 411 acre prescribed burn near Blue Canyon and Barns Mountain, 30 miles east of Fresno. Smoke from the burn may visible from many local communities including the Shaver Lake area around Bretz Mill and Sierra Cedar subdivisions, the upper portions of the four-lane on State Highway168, Burrough Valley and the San Joaquin Valley.

The objective of the prescribed burn is to restore, enhance and sustain a healthy forest ecosystem. Specific objectives include reducing the threat of wildfires to the community of Shaver Lake, reduce overgrown forest vegetation, improve wildlife habitat, maintain plant species traditionally used by Native Americans, and reintroduce fire as a component of a healthy ecosystem.

The prescribed fire will be ignited when conditions are optimal including favorable weather and air quality. Forest Service firefighting resources supporting the effort include two engines, a 20-person hot shot crew, two dozers and two helicopters.

The Forest Service is using the best available control measures and fire resources to reduce smoke impacts on local residences. By burning during cooler and wetter times of the year, these burns are less intense, easier to control and produce significantly less smoke than a wildfire during the summer months. Signs will be posted for safety and information on roadways entering areas where burning is taking place.
